check_elem(elem, except_type) click to toggle source
# File lib/puppet-lint/plugins/check_trailing_comma.rb, line 90
def check_elem(elem, except_type)
  lbo_token = elem[:tokens][-1].prev_code_token

  # If we get a token indicating the end of a HEREDOC, backtrack
  # until we find HEREDOC_OPEN. That is the line which should
  # be examined for the comma.
  if lbo_token && %i[HEREDOC HEREDOC_POST].include?(lbo_token.type)
    lbo_token = lbo_token.prev_code_token while lbo_token && lbo_token.type != :HEREDOC_OPEN
  end

  if lbo_token && lbo_token.type != except_type &&
     elem[:tokens][-1].type != :SEMIC &&
     lbo_token.type != :COMMA &&
     lbo_token.next_token.type == :NEWLINE
    notify :warning, {
      message: 'missing trailing comma after last element',
      line: lbo_token.next_token.line,
      column: lbo_token.next_token.column,
      token: lbo_token.next_token,
    }
  end
end

fix(problem) click to toggle source
# File lib/puppet-lint/plugins/check_trailing_comma.rb, line 135
def fix(problem)
  comma = PuppetLint::Lexer::Token.new(
    :COMMA,
    ',',
    problem[:token].line,
    problem[:token].column,
  )

  idx = tokens.index(problem[:token])
  tokens.insert(idx, comma)
end
